Output d8363053ed04a60029b14c6097ea38daf04b4e18922be7c197337c5329819bfe:9

value
570795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18dd356e15f248b569cb62c790c9ac929fb39dcc OP_EQUAL
address
33xV8zro5nNgKyd31rqFyNJCWBnbfoDFmc
transaction
d8363053ed04a60029b14c6097ea38daf04b4e18922be7c197337c5329819bfe
confirmations
164956
spent
true